HSBC has new fleet of ATMs

HSBC Bermuda announced the rollout of a new fleet of ATMs across the island, representing a significant investment in enhancing customers’ everyday banking experience. The upgraded machines deliver faster, more reliable self-service banking through improved technology and expanded functionality, making routine
transactions easier and more convenient.

The new ATMs feature advanced chip-enabled card readers, replacing the previous reliance on magnetic stripe technology to reduce card-reading errors and improve transaction reliability. Customers will also benefit from enhanced cash deposit capabilities, including upgraded immediate credit functionality that enables cash deposits to be credited to their account instantly, eliminating the need to queue at a teller for routine transactions.

“We know our customers expect banking to fit seamlessly into their daily lives, whether they’re visiting a branch or using our self-service channels,” said Tanya Bule, HSBC Bermuda Head of International, Wealth and Premier Banking. “This investment reflects our commitment to continually improving the experiences that matter most to our customers. By modernising our ATM network, we’re making everyday banking more reliable, more intuitive and giving customers greater confidence that they can access the services they need, when they need them.”
